About This Audiobook
Dive into the tumultuous era of American slavery with 'The Zealot and the Emancipator,' a gripping audiobook that captures the fiery confrontations between John Brown, the radical abolitionist, and Abraham Lincoln, the pragmatic emancipator. Historian H. W. Brands masterfully weaves their intertwined lives through a tapestry of political intrigue, personal conflict, and moral struggle.
